Brian Urlacher stands as one of the most iconic figures in modern NFL history, a defensive stalwart who redefined the linebacker position in the early 2000s. Born on May 25, 1978, in Lovington, New Mexico, and raised in Loving, Texas, Urlacher’s journey from a small-town athlete to a global sports superstar is a testament to relentless drive and exceptional talent. His career with the Chicago Bears, spanning from 2000 to 2012, cemented his legacy as a tenacious tackler, a fearless leader, and a symbol of blue-collar excellence in professional football. Beyond the gridiron, Urlacher’s marketability and personality have allowed him to transcend the sport, securing a financial legacy that underscores his impact far beyond his playing days, with an estimated Brian Urlacher net worth reflecting his successful career and numerous business ventures.
When discussing the financial trajectory of any actor, the initial and most significant source of income is usually their primary television or film role. Atticus Shaffer’s tenure on "The Middle" was substantial, spanning nine seasons. As a main cast member on a top-rated ABC sitcom, he commanded a considerable salary. While the exact figures of his contract are not publicly disclosed, industry insiders and reports consistently placed his annual earnings in the range of $60,000 to $70,000 during the show's peak seasons. Given that he started as a child actor and grew up on set, his pay likely increased incrementally over the years. Multiplying this annual rate over nearly a decade provides a substantial base income. More importantly, as a series regular, he would have been entitled to residual payments and royalties. In the entertainment industry, residuals are a crucial component of long-term wealth, providing actors with a percentage of the revenue generated from syndication, streaming, and DVD sales. "The Middle" enjoyed immense popularity in syndication, airing frequently on various channels, which means Shaffer has likely continued to earn passive income long after the show left the airwaves. This residual income is a significant factor when calculating his lifetime earnings and overall net worth.
